Background and Analysis:
Home Fund Advisory Recommendation:
The Olympia Home Fund Advisory Board unanimously recommends awarding Family Support Center of South Sound $1 million for the creation of 62 new homes for homeless children and their families as well as survivors of domestic violence. An award letter drafted by staff (attached) would accompany future applications for funds and make this project more competitive against similar projects in other jurisdictions. If all funds are awarded and other award letter criteria are met staff would draft a contract for your review and approval.

Impact of this Award:
This project will help create 62 new homes for homeless children and their families as well as survivors of domestic violence. If this project were completed today, the units could be immediately filled with households with children in the Coordinated Entry system, those in shelter and other prioritized homeless families. In the first year, it is expected that this project will serve 209 children, parents and survivors of domestic violence. This housing plans to be fully occupied by March 2023.
